Mercs Posted May 7, 2018 Share Posted May 7, 2018 I shot the new Shadow a few times already, and it has definitely lived up to my expectations. I threw some palm swell grips on it the other day, and just gonna shoot it as stock for a couple weeks. I’ve shot some gritty, stagey Cz 75’s and then also some customized Shadows, and I have to say my stock Shadow is brilliantly smooth. I love it. I can’t wait to drop some CGW parts in it. I already have a stainless race hammer, 10x bushing, extended fp, and all springs/pins ready to go. Just waiting on the RRK-3 to complete my parts list. I’m also looking for a full size hammer strut, so that I can leave the stock disco and strut on the Shadow hammer when I remove it. These are out of stock everywhere I look.
